Cybersecurity Mentorship Program
Pairing candidates with experienced professionals, start to finish
To connect experienced cybersecurity professionals to provide "ground-up" guidance, translate complex technical concepts into usable skills, and build on our nation’s defense in-depth by fostering a stronger, more resilient cyber workforce through active, professional relationships.

Key Deliverables
People — Mentor/Mentee Engagement
- Mentor-Driven Outreach: Mentors initiate the relationship by reaching out to assessed candidates and scheduling the initial kickoff meeting.
- Personalized Guidance: Experienced mentors provide expertise in specific areas (e.g., IT infrastructure or cybersecurity) to guide candidates through their certification journey.
- VTP Cert Office Hours: Weekly virtual sessions held every Thursday from 7:00 PM to 7:30 PM EST for mentors and candidates to mingle, share their journeys, and ask questions.
- Culture Integration: Mentors actively assist professionals and candidates in becoming comfortable with VTP’s unique systems, processes, and organizational culture.

Policy — Framework & Accountability
- Mutual Commitment Agreement: Formalizes expectations, such as candidates dedicating 5–10 hours per week to study and mentors committing to bi-weekly check-ins.
- Structured Roadmap: A recommended 6-month timeline covering milestones from the initial kickoff to practice exams and post-certification debriefs.
- Voluntary & Conditional Participation: Ensures participation remains voluntary while establishing clear grounds for "dismissal for cause" (e.g., ethical violations or prolonged lack of progress).
- Alumni & Mentor Pipeline: Graduates who successfully complete their certification are eligible to join advanced programs or apply to become VTP mentors themselves.

Impact
Lowers the barrier to entry by providing candidates with real-world exposure rather than just theory, ultimately creating a pipeline of talent ready to support community, nonprofit, and public-sector cybersecurity needs.
